Mark Bosnich Named Worst Signing by Paul Scholes

In a recent discussion about Manchester United's history, Paul Scholes did not hold back, declaring Mark Bosnich as the worst signing ever. According to Scholes, Bosnich's performance was so poor that he remarked, 'He couldn't kick a football.'
